Harrisburg

English dictionary entry

Meanings

name
  1. A city, the state capital of Pennsylvania.
  2. A city, the county seat of Poinsett County, Arkansas.
  3. A city, the county seat of Saline County, Illinois.
  4. A city in Oregon.
  5. A city in South Dakota.
  6. A town in New York.
  7. A town in North Carolina.
  8. A village in Missouri.
  9. A village in Ohio.
  10. A census-designated place, the county seat of Banner County, Nebraska.

Etymology

From Harris + -burg. The capital of Pennsylvania was named for John Harris Sr..
